West Virginia sophomore punter Oliver Straw has been named to the Ray Guy Award Watch List, an award given to the nation's top punter at the end of the season.

In his first year at WVU, Straw finished with 48 punts for 2,029 yards, averaging 42.3 yards per punt. 17 of those punts pinned opponents inside their own 20-yard line, seven went 50+ yards, and his long for the season was 63 yards which came against Texas Tech.

The Ray Guy Award committee will trim the list to 10 semifinalists on November 10th. A national body of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S) sports information directors, media representatives and previous Ray Guy Award winners will then vote for the top three finalists to be announced on November 22nd. The winner will be announced live during The Home Depot College Football Awards airing on ESPN in December 2023.
